Is SpinSuccess a Scam?
First of all, what is SpinSuccess?
According to their website, SpinSuccess is a search engine submission service specialized in “promoting top earning affiliate web sites” that guarantees that they can do the same for you “no matter what type of web site that you use for your business“.
Here is one of their first statements:
“Here at SpinSuccess, we have been helping our clients gain staggering amounts of search engine exposure since December of 1999.”
If you check WhoIs database you find out that SpinSuccess.com has been created on March 2004. Oops!
One of their first promises is that “Our team will first manually submit your site to the top 15 search engines“. What exactly are these top 15 search engines in their opinon it’s not very clear. However, they use some logos on their website and you may suppose that the logos belongs to these top 15 search engine.
Let’s take a look at some of the logos:
1) DMOZ – this is not a search engine but a directory. More than this, your affiliate website will never be accepted in this directory. Read here DMOZ policy.
2) Altavista – this is finally a search engine but … Altavista does not have its database of websites but use Yahoo!’s database. So … no one can submit your website to Altavista. Check here and see for yourself.
3-4) Lycos & Hotbot – Hotbot’s Help page states very clear that “Lycos does not have a website submission form for Lycos Search or HotBot“. No one can submit your website to Hotbot or Lycos …
5) AOL – AOL uses Google, no one can submit your website to AOL.
6) About.com – is not a search engine
No more comments … but a final remark …
SpinSuccess also states that “in order to ensure indexing, your site must be submitted to the major search engines by hand“.
Sorry, but that’s a lie. There is nothing wrong to submit your website by hand to the major search engines, but this is NOT a must for ensuring indexing of your website.
Get a free blog hosted by WordPress, post a few posts for a couple of days and you’ll see that your website will be indexed by Google very soon if your website’s link is inserted in the posts of your blog. Or register with a forum having a high traffic – like Warrior Forum – setup your signature so that to contain your website’s URL, post a few comments on the forum and within a few days your website is indexed by Google. Without ANYONE submitting your website “to the major search engines by hand”.
Now you decide what is the answer to the question from the title of this article …
Usually when there is something wrong with a company or program, the people immediatelly start screaming SCAM! Well, in the real world there are more colors than black and white. That’s why I really cannot say that SpinSuccess is a scam. However, what it’s very clear is that they don’t know what they are talking about … or … they mislead the visitors in order to make them buy (not very nice marketing technique anyway).

=====
I have a website http://www.spinsuccess.com that I need testimonials for. I am willing to pay $10 per testimonial with a bonus of up to another $10 based on the quality and my satisfaction of your work.
Step 1 – Visit http://www.spinsuccess.com to see the site you will be leaving a testimonial for.
Step 2 – Prepare your testimonial. Must sound natural and not “read” so do it on the fly. You are a member of one of the following. GDI, Success University, Traffic Oasis, Pay it Forward 4 Profits or SFI. Your testimonial will state how great the spinsuccess service has been for your website and how you have had success making money with the business opportunity part of it.
For example: “Hi there, my name is Joe Shmoe from Atlanta GA and I just wanted to call in and say how happy I am with SpinSuccess. They have gotten a tonne of quality traffic to my site via the search engines. I also was able to make around $1400 per month promoting SpinSuccess to people on the net. Thanks alot SpinSuccess!”
Your ability to be creative and come up with a ground sounding testimonial will determine how much of a bonus I will pay you ontop of the $10.
No bidding necessary, click on http://members.InstantAudio.com/st1.asp?c=562942&P=SpinSuccess to get started and email me at andrew@lucidic.com when done. I will review your job and pay you via paypal.
Thanks!
Andrew Christiansen
==========
Not very ethical, huh?

I agree, total waste of time and money. I submitted a site with my own unique domain name and hosting, which should help with search engines. I had hit tracking on it, as well as some google adsense, and their counts disagreed (adsense was showing less visitors).
This leads me to believe that about 5-10 “vistors” a day I was getting, were either computer generated, or pop-under, or some other bogus visitors.
Needless to say, I never got a single opt-in, out of supposed few hundreds of visitors over the 3 months I was with them, whereas that page was converting at above 10% when advertised to real audience throu PPC etc.
I think their “business model” is stalling people to stay for a few months, telling them it takes time to see results. Those who make a few referrals might stick for longer (if they don’t have a conscience).
As for Tabatha Grant and Rosalind Archer, they are either unscrupulous referral junkies, or just aliases for the services owner.
Did you notice that as soon as a new popular program launches, these 2 “ladies” claim within days they got dozens of sign ups in it, with this service?
Doesn’t it take at least a few weeks to see results?
Also, some sign ups claims on the pitch page of the program are suspicipus. Take GDI for example..The service owner (Lucidic Inc.) was on GDI leaderboards 2 years ago, supposedly using this service..Why is he nowhere to be seen on GDI leaderboards since?
Anyways, the evidence is overwhelming. This is a bogus service, and you’re better off investing into some real, proven advertising methods.
